Sec. 27-107. Prohibition of automatic dialing devices.
(a) No person shall use or cause to be used any automatic telephone device or telephone attachment that directly or indirectly causes a public primary telephone trunk line of the Lynchburg Emergency Communications Center to be utilized and then reproduces a pre-recorded message or signal.
(b) Within sixty (60) days after the effective date of this article all existing automatic dialing devices programmed to select a public primary telephone trunk line of the city and then reproduce any pre-recorded message or signal shall be disconnected. (Ord. No. O-91-276, 11-12-91, eff. 1-1-92)
